Southampton V Middlesbrough In Pictures

In a quiet International week we once again go back into our picture archives to take a look at some of the action from previous clashes with Boro both home and away.

We start with Marian Pahars celebrating his goal in a 1-1 draw with Middlesbrough at the Dell on March 3rd 2000, the Latvian Michael Owen scored on the brink of half time, but within 60 seconds of the restart Boro were awarded a penalty from which they scored the final goal of the game

We fast forward now to Sunday 11th December 2016 when Saints fans were still smarting from the exit from the Europa League after a 1-1 home draw with Beer Sheva a few days earlier, this would be a dire game settled in the 53rd minute with a wonder goal from Sofiane Boufal on 53 minutes.

The return up in the North East came on Saturday 13th May 2017 and bizarrely enough Saints fans were asking similar questions of then manager Claude Puel, the issue was that after both Jose Fonte & Virgil Van Dijk were now unavailable, Fonte through leaving and Van Dijk through injury, Puel seemed to have a strange desire to play a 23 year old who had only made his League debut for the club in the January, Puel had signed Martin Caceres an experienced player both at club and International level, but he sat on the bench for 3 months and only made 1 appearance in his time at the club, in this game.

Why he never played before or for that matter in the final two games of the season was one of the questions that will perhaps never be answered, only one man knows the answer Claude Puel and his failure to try him earlier in the season perhaps was a big factor in costing him his job.

Anyway we won 2-1, Jay Rodrigues scoring just before the break and Nathan Redmond putting us 2-0 up on 57 minutes before Patrick Bamford gave the home side hope on 72 minutes.
